Lighting does far more than simply illuminate rooms. It sets the mood, highlights architectural features, improves safety, and can dramatically reduce your energy bills when done properly. Done Right Electrical Northmead specialises in lighting installations across Northmead, bringing years of experience to residential and commercial projects of all sizes.

Our lighting services cover the full spectrum of indoor and outdoor solutions. Inside your property, we install LED downlights that provide clean, efficient illumination while slashing power consumption compared to traditional halogen bulbs. We fit pendant lights over kitchen islands and dining tables, adding style and focused task lighting exactly where you need it. For ambiance and flexibility, we install dimmer switches that let you adjust lighting levels throughout the day, compatible with LED, halogen, and incandescent lights.

Feature and accent lighting deserves special mention. These installations highlight artwork, illuminate shelving, or draw attention to architectural details that make your property unique. We use strip lighting, recessed options, and carefully positioned fixtures tailored to your space, creating visual interest and depth.

Outdoor and garden lighting extends your living space beyond four walls whilst improving security. We design and install lighting for landscaping, driveways, garden beds, decks, and pool areas throughout Northmead. These systems enhance safety along paths and steps, deter intruders with strategic placement, and create stunning visual effects that boost property value.

Security and sensor lighting forms another crucial category. Motion-sensor lights and floodlights around driveways, entrances, and backyards provide automatic illumination when movement is detected, combining convenience with deterrence. Emergency lighting for commercial properties ensures visibility during power loss or evacuations, keeping you compliant with safety regulations.

For tech-savvy property owners, we configure smart lighting systems controlled by apps, voice assistants, or automation platforms. These Wi-Fi or Zigbee-enabled solutions let you control lighting from anywhere, set schedules, and create scenes that transform your environment with a simple command.

Every lighting installation begins with understanding how you use your space and what you want to achieve. Our electricians assess your property's electrical capacity, recommend appropriate fixtures and placement, and ensure installations meet Australian Standards for safety and performance. When adding multiple lights or significant loads, we inspect your switchboard and recommend upgrades if needed to ensure safe power distribution.

    How many times have you wished for a power point exactly where you're standing? Modern life demands electrical access throughout our homes and businesses, yet many Northmead properties still rely on outdated electrical layouts that force residents to juggle power boards and extension cords. Done Right Electrical Northmead solves this frustration with professional power point installation services that put electricity exactly where you need it.

    Indoor power point installation covers every room and situation. We fit single, double, and USB-equipped outlets in kitchens, bedrooms, living areas, and offices. Home offices particularly benefit from dedicated circuits and multiple outlets to handle computers, monitors, printers, and other equipment without overloading circuits. Kitchens need sufficient outlets for the growing array of appliances modern cooking demands, properly positioned to meet safety clearances around sinks and cooktops.

    USB power points have become increasingly popular, providing convenient charging for phones and tablets without bulky adaptors. These combination outlets maintain standard power access while adding integrated USB ports that charge devices efficiently.

    Outdoor power point installation opens up new possibilities for Northmead properties. Weatherproof outlets on patios, in gardens, around sheds, and near pool areas provide safe, reliable power for outdoor entertaining, garden maintenance, and recreation. These purpose-built units withstand moisture and UV exposure whilst maintaining safety standards crucial for exterior applications.

    Beyond new installations, we handle power point repairs and upgrades for existing outlets showing signs of wear or damage. Loose outlets, discoloured faceplates, warm sockets, or outlets that don't hold plugs firmly all indicate problems requiring professional attention. We diagnose faults, replace damaged components, and upgrade older units to modern standards that support higher loads or offer additional features like USB charging.

    Our electricians assess your current electrical system before installing new power points, ensuring circuits can handle additional load safely. When existing circuits are already near capacity, we install new dedicated circuits from your switchboard, properly sized for the intended use. This approach prevents nuisance tripping, reduces fire risk, and ensures your electrical system operates reliably.

    Commercial properties have distinct power requirements. We install power points positioned for office layouts, retail displays, and commercial equipment, often incorporating data and network cabling installation during the same visit for complete connectivity solutions.

    Every power point installation meets Australian electrical standards and receives proper testing before we consider the job complete. This diligence ensures safety, longevity, and reliable performance for years of trouble-free service throughout your Northmead property.

      LED lighting technology consumes significantly less electricity than traditional halogen or incandescent bulbs whilst producing equivalent or better light output. A typical LED downlight uses around 8-12 watts compared to 50-60 watts for halogen equivalents, representing roughly 80% reduction in power consumption. Over the life of LED bulbs, this translates to substantial savings on electricity bills. LED lights also generate far less heat, reducing cooling costs during warmer months. The longevity of quality LED products means fewer replacements, with typical lifespans exceeding many years of regular use. When we install LED lighting throughout your property, we calculate potential savings based on your specific usage patterns and existing lighting setup. Many property owners recover installation costs within a couple of years through reduced electricity bills, after which the savings continue accumulating. Modern LED options also offer excellent colour rendering and dimming capabilities, ensuring you don't sacrifice lighting quality for efficiency.
      In most situations, we can install additional power points without extensive rewiring throughout your property. The process depends on several factors including proximity to existing circuits, current electrical load on those circuits, and accessibility of wiring routes. When existing circuits have adequate capacity and accessible cable routes exist through wall cavities or ceiling spaces, installation becomes relatively straightforward. We run new cables from the nearest suitable power point or junction box to the new location, ensuring proper cable sizing and protection. For properties where existing circuits are already heavily loaded, we may recommend installing a new dedicated circuit from your switchboard, providing fresh capacity specifically for the new outlets. This approach prevents overloading and ensures reliable performance. Older properties occasionally present accessibility challenges requiring creative solutions like surface-mounted conduit, but we always find practical ways to deliver the power access you need. During the initial assessment, we examine your specific situation and explain the most effective approach for your particular property and requirements.
      Outdoor electrical installations require special considerations beyond indoor work due to weather exposure and safety requirements. We use weatherproof power points and lighting fixtures specifically rated for outdoor use, with appropriate ingress protection ratings that prevent moisture and dust entry. Cable routes to outdoor locations must be properly protected, typically running through conduit buried underground or secured along building exteriors. Outdoor circuits require additional safety protection including residual current devices that detect earth leakage faults and disconnect power within milliseconds. Placement of outdoor power points considers practical usage whilst maintaining safe clearances from water features, swimming pools, and garden beds. Outdoor lighting installations involve careful planning around landscape features, desired lighting effects, and safety requirements for paths and steps. We work with property owners to create outdoor electrical systems that enhance usability and aesthetics whilst meeting stringent safety standards. Many properties benefit from multiple outdoor circuits serving different areas, providing flexibility for entertaining, garden maintenance, and recreational activities throughout your outdoor spaces.
      Several indicators suggest your switchboard may need upgrading before adding significant new electrical loads. Properties still using ceramic fuses rather than modern circuit breakers definitely require switchboard replacement before expanding electrical capacity. Frequent tripping of circuit breakers when using multiple appliances indicates circuits are already operating near capacity, leaving no headroom for additional loads. Switchboards lacking safety switches need upgrading to meet current standards and protect occupants from electric shock. If your switchboard shows signs of age like rust, damaged components, or outdated wiring methods, upgrading becomes essential for safety reasons regardless of capacity considerations. Many older properties throughout the region have switchboards undersized for modern electrical demands, originally designed when households used far fewer appliances and devices. During our assessment for lighting and power installations, we always inspect your switchboard and discuss any upgrade requirements before proceeding. Modern switchboards provide better circuit organisation, improved safety features, adequate capacity for current and future needs, and compliance with Australian electrical standards. When upgrades are necessary, we explain the scope clearly and coordinate switchboard and installation work efficiently to minimise disruption.
      Older homes present unique considerations for lighting upgrades, balancing modern efficiency with respect for original character. Many established properties feature high ceilings, ornate cornices, and architectural details that deserve thoughtful lighting design. LED downlights work beautifully in these spaces when carefully positioned to provide even illumination without overwhelming period features. Pendant lights and chandeliers with LED-compatible fittings maintain traditional aesthetics whilst delivering modern efficiency. We often recommend feature lighting to highlight architectural elements like timber beams, archways, or decorative plasterwork, creating visual interest that celebrates the home's character. Dimmer switches provide flexibility to adjust lighting levels for different activities and times of day, particularly valuable in multipurpose living spaces. Older wiring sometimes requires upgrading during lighting installations, which we identify during initial assessments. We work sensitively with heritage properties, routing new cables discreetly and preserving original features wherever possible. The goal is lighting that enhances how you live in your home whilst respecting what makes it special. Many property owners are pleasantly surprised by how dramatically improved lighting transforms older homes, revealing details and creating ambiance that had been lost to inadequate or outdated lighting schemes.
      Smart lighting systems adapt to virtually any property type, from compact units to expansive family homes and commercial premises. These systems work by replacing standard light switches with smart switches, or by using smart bulbs that communicate with control hubs. The beauty of modern smart lighting lies in its flexibility, working with existing wiring whilst adding sophisticated control capabilities. Basic smart lighting requires only power and wireless connectivity through your property's Wi-Fi network or dedicated smart home protocols. More advanced installations might incorporate motion sensors, daylight sensors, and integration with other smart home systems for comprehensive automation. We configure smart lighting to match your technical comfort level, from simple app control of individual lights through to complex scenes and automation routines that adjust lighting throughout the day. Voice control through popular assistants provides convenient hands-free operation. Energy monitoring features help track consumption and identify opportunities for further savings. Commercial properties benefit from scheduling and zoning capabilities that reduce energy waste in unoccupied areas. During installation, we ensure reliable wireless coverage throughout your property and configure systems for intuitive operation. We also provide guidance on using smart lighting features effectively, helping you get maximum value from this technology investment.
